Web2 • Dispersion (London) forces – Instantaneous dipole – a dipole that results from an instantaneous fluctuation of the electron cloud in a particle – The instantaneous dipole can induce a dipole in a nearby particle and create an induced dipole in it ¾Dispersion (London) forces – IFs between an instantaneous dipole and an induced dipole in a ...
